Crow Couple - Nov. 27, 2021

a quick kiss

with shoulders touching

the old couple sits

front row on a wire

facing the walk bridge

humans

and their noisy busyness

leashed dogs and bicycles

cups and bags and jackets

cross back and forth


and not one

not a single one

not even once

cocks a head

to look up
